Prepare in five minutes

Print one set of student worksheets per learner or pair. Bring pencils and blank paper. Use the supplied refrigerator explanation; no working appliance is necessary. Read the worked example and safety notes before starting.

Invite students to distinguish evidence from guesses, compare a simpler option with an AI proposal, and explain who remains in control. “Do not add AI” is a legitimate conclusion.

Designed for discussion, not product experiments

Keep all failure scenarios on paper. Do not open or modify machines, change appliance settings, block ventilation, test safety devices, or interrupt power and networks. If you use an optional AI extension, an adult operates an appropriate service using invented examples only. The complete session works without it.
